Our Verdict
The Rab Ramshaw Pull-On provides steady warmth and excellent comfort through its Thermic fleece, which feels smooth on the outside and soft against the skin. At 397g (Medium), it sits on the heavier side for a grid-style fleece, offering dependable insulation and a robust, well-made feel.
Rab calls this a relaxed fit; however, I find the fit a little too relaxed. For context, I take a large in every Rab product, but found this to be oversized, perfect for casual wear, but too loose for efficient layering on the hills, so I sized down to a medium, which fit much better. Sizing down is the consensus among everyone here in the UOG office, across both men’s and women’s versions.
The deep front zip allows easy ventilation, and the chest pocket adds useful storage. Stitching and finish are tidy throughout, creating a durable, versatile midlayer suited to year-round mountain use.

Features
- YKK® VISLON® deep venting centre front zip with zip guard
- 1 YKK® zipped chest pocket with Matrix™ overlay and lightweight zip pull
- Split hem for freedom of movement
- Overlocked seams for increased comfort and improved fit
- Scalloped hem improves warmth and protection on lower back
Specifications
- Small weighs: 383g
- Medium weighs: 397g
- Large weighs: 420g
- XLarge weighs: 447g
- Fit: Relaxed
- Centre back length (Size M): 75cm /29.5 inch
Material & Construction
- Thermic™ Soft Textured Fleece with Brushed Backer (272gsm)
- Main Body: 100% Polyester (Recycled fibres)
- Panels: 88% Polyamide (Recycled fibres) 12% Elastane
